At its core, red light therapy is a form of photobiomodulation (PBM). This complex term describes a beautifully simple process: the use of specific wavelengths of light to stimulate cellular function. Unlike ultraviolet light, which can damage the skin, the therapeutic wavelengths used in PBM—primarily red and near-infrared lights—are gentle and restorative. When these photons of light penetrate the skin and reach the mitochondria (the power plants of our cells), they trigger a biochemical cascade. This interaction boosts the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the cellular currency of energy. Enhanced ATP means cells have more fuel to operate efficiently, repair themselves, and perform their designated functions with greater vigor. This foundational mechanism of biostimulation is what drives the diverse benefits reported by users.

It is crucial to distinguish this therapy from other light-based treatments. Cold laser therapy is essentially a more focused, higher-intensity form of photobiomodulation, often used by healthcare professionals for targeted treatment of injuries. Red light phototherapy, typically delivered via larger panels or beds, offers a broader, more generalized application, making it excellent for full-body wellness and skin health. Both, however, operate on the same PBM principle. The Science-Backed Applications of Red Light

The appeal of Red Light Therapy Tuscarora lies in its wide range of applications, each supported by a growing body of clinical research.

Skin Health and Anti-Aging: One of the most popular uses is for cosmetic and dermatological improvements. The biostimulation effect promotes collagen and elastin production, the proteins responsible for skin's firmness and elasticity. This can lead to a visible reduction in fine lines and wrinkles, improved skin texture, and a more radiant complexion. Furthermore, the anti-inflammatory properties of red light phototherapy make it a compelling adjunct therapy for conditions like rosacea, psoriasis, and acne, helping to calm redness and support the skin's healing processes.

Pain Relief and Muscle Recovery: For active individuals in Tuscarora and those dealing with chronic pain, red light therapy offers a promising alternative. The near-infrared lights penetrate deeply into joints and muscle tissue, reducing inflammation and increasing circulation. This can accelerate the healing of sprains, ease arthritis discomfort, and relieve muscle soreness after exertion. The reduction in oxidative stress and the boost in cellular repair mechanisms explain why many athletes and physical therapy clinics incorporate PBM to shorten recovery times and manage pain without pharmaceuticals.

Wound Healing and Tissue Repair: The fundamental action of photobiomodulation on cellular energy production directly translates to enhanced healing. Studies have shown that it can speed up the recovery of wounds, burns, and surgical incisions by modulating inflammation and encouraging the proliferation of new tissue. This application underscores the therapy's role not just in aesthetics or performance, but in fundamental biological repair.

Mental Well-being and Circadian Rhythm: Emerging research points to potential benefits for brain health. Some studies suggest PBM may have neuroprotective effects and could help with symptoms of depression and anxiety. Furthermore, exposure to red light in the morning may support healthy circadian rhythms, unlike the blue light from screens which can disrupt them, potentially improving sleep quality—a cornerstone of overall health.

Consistency is key. Unlike invasive procedures, the effects of red light phototherapy are cumulative. Most protocols recommend sessions several times per week, often starting with shorter durations (e.g., 5-10 minutes per area) and gradually increasing. The experience is typically pleasant and passive; users simply sit or stand near the device, feeling only a gentle warmth from the infrared lights, if any sensation at all.
